Glucocorticoid-resistant Th17 cells are selectively attenuated by cyclosporine A.

Abstract excerpt
Glucocorticoids remain the cornerstone of treatment for inflammatory conditions, but their utility is limited by a plethora of side effects. One of the key goals of immunotherapy across medical disciplines is to minimize patients' glucocorticoid use.
